Job Summary
Psychiatric/DD Nurse 15% Recruitment Supplement and 10% Supplement for 2nd and 3rd shifts (2600018Q). Full‑time position at Columbus Developmental Center, 1601 West Broad Street, Columbus, OH 43222‑1087.
OrganizationDevelopmental Disabilities – Columbus Developmental Center.
Compensation and BenefitsSalary: $34.96 per hour, increasing to $36.65 in 180 days. Additional 2nd/3rd shift differential: $1.50 + $3.50 per hour plus recruitment supplement $5.24 per hour. Annual increases and longevity supplement after 5 years.
- Medical coverage through Ohio Med PPO plan.
- Dental, vision and basic life insurance premiums free after one year of continuous service.
- Paid time off: vacation, personal and sick leave, 11 paid holidays, childbirth/adoption/foster care leave.
- Retirement:
Ohio Public Employees Retirement System (OPERS) with 10% employee contribution and 14% employer contribution. - Deferred compensation through Ohio Deferred Compensation 457(b) plan.
- Primary nursing responsibilities for assigned residents: nursing treatment planning, chart audits, medication management, infection control, physical assessments, and health‑care related scenario programs.
- Communicate medical information to parents/guardians and interdisciplinary team members.
- Fill in for psychiatric meetings, work with physicians, and process physician orders.
- Schedule follow‑up care and manage preventative health screening.
- Assist with feeding, grooming, self‑care; evaluate injuries and administer first aid.
- Respond to medical emergencies and make decisions in supervisor’s absence.
- Serve as member of interdisciplinary team, submit reports, and provide clinical oversight to LPNs.
- Assist in training of new staff and conduct in‑service training sessions.
- Current registered professional nurse license in Ohio issued by the Board of Nursing.
